Columbus Blue Jackets recall defenceman Dalton Prout after John Moore is hurt in practice

COLUMBUS, Ohio - The Columbus Blue Jackets have recalled defenceman Dalton Prout from their American Hockey League affiliate in Springfield, Mass.

He may fill in for defenceman John Moore, who sustained an upper-body injury during Friday's morning skate.

The 22-year-old Prout, who is scoreless in five NHL games, had a goal, eight assists and 73 penalty minutes in 40 games at Springfield this season.

He was Columbus' sixth-round pick, 154th overall, in the 2010 draft.
